Crawlspace Waterproofing in Birmingham, AL
Crawlspace waterproofing services focus on protecting the area beneath a home from moisture, water intrusion, and potential damage. These projects typically involve installing barriers, drainage systems, and moisture control solutions to prevent water from seeping into the crawlspace. Homeowners often request this service to address issues like persistent dampness, musty odors, mold growth, or water leaks that can compromise the structural integrity and indoor air quality of a property.
Before requesting crawlspace waterproofing, property owners usually want to understand the extent of existing water problems, the causes of moisture intrusion, and the types of solutions available. It’s important to assess whether drainage improvements, vapor barriers, or sump pumps are appropriate for the specific conditions of the crawlspace. Clear communication about the property's current state and future goals can help determine the most effective waterproofing approach.

Common Crawlspace Waterproofing Jobs
Basement Crawlspace Waterproofing - prevents water intrusion and protects against mold growth beneath the home.
Interior Drainage Systems - diverts excess water away from the crawlspace to keep it dry.
Vapor Barriers - reduces moisture levels and improves air quality inside the crawlspace.
Exterior Waterproofing - seals foundation walls to prevent water from seeping in around the home’s exterior.
Sump Pump Installation - removes accumulated water and reduces the risk of flooding in the crawlspace.
Dehumidification Solutions - controls humidity levels to prevent mold and wood rot in the crawlspace.
Crawlspace Waterproofing Questions
What is crawlspace waterproofing? It involves sealing and protecting the crawlspace area to prevent moisture intrusion and water damage.
Why is waterproofing a crawlspace important? Proper waterproofing helps prevent mold growth, wood rot, and structural issues caused by excess moisture.
What types of projects require crawlspace waterproofing? Common projects include addressing persistent dampness, water leaks, or preparing a space for potential finishing or insulation.
How does crawlspace waterproofing improve property value? It enhances the home's durability and reduces the risk of costly repairs related to moisture damage.
